HomeSort by relevance Sort by last modified time
    Searched defs:SupportsWeakPtr (Results 1 - 2 of 2) sorted by null

  /external/libchrome/base/memory/
weak_ptr.h 82 template <typename T> class SupportsWeakPtr;
153 // SupportsWeakPtr<>.
158 // from SupportsWeakPtr<Base>. See base::AsWeakPtr() below for a helper
165 "AsWeakPtr argument must inherit from SupportsWeakPtr");
171 // which is an instance of SupportsWeakPtr<Base>. We can then safely
175 Derived* t, const SupportsWeakPtr<Base>&) {
247 friend class SupportsWeakPtr<T>;
298 // A class may extend from SupportsWeakPtr to let others take weak pointers to
300 // pointers. However, since SupportsWeakPtr's destructor won't invalidate
304 class SupportsWeakPtr : public internal::SupportsWeakPtrBase
    [all...]
  /external/libweave/third_party/chromium/base/memory/
weak_ptr.h 80 template <typename T> class SupportsWeakPtr;
150 // SupportsWeakPtr<>.
155 // from SupportsWeakPtr<Base>. See base::AsWeakPtr() below for a helper
162 "AsWeakPtr argument must inherit from SupportsWeakPtr");
168 // which is an instance of SupportsWeakPtr<Base>. We can then safely
172 Derived* t, const SupportsWeakPtr<Base>&) {
244 friend class SupportsWeakPtr<T>;
295 // A class may extend from SupportsWeakPtr to let others take weak pointers to
297 // pointers. However, since SupportsWeakPtr's destructor won't invalidate
301 class SupportsWeakPtr : public internal::SupportsWeakPtrBase
    [all...]

Completed in 534 milliseconds